自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 收藏
  • 关注

原创 给你一个二叉树的根节点 root , 检查它是否轴对称。

【代码】【无标题】

2023-08-03 23:00:01 106

原创 【图像处理学习笔记opencv】抠图

将不感兴趣区域像素值置为0,感兴趣区域像素值不变。方法:使用查找表将感兴趣区域置为1,感兴趣区域像素值置为0。然后与原图相乘。代码如下(示例):

2022-06-16 14:26:06 533 1

原创 【图像处理学习笔记opencv】膨胀与腐蚀

膨胀:锚点邻域最大像素值代替锚点处像素值。腐蚀:锚点邻域最小像素值代替锚点处像素值。如图为矩形(3*3)框,还可以为圆形框、椭圆框等。腐蚀(矩形)代码如下(示例):膨胀代码(矩形)如下(示例):2.Opencv库函数实现:dilate(膨胀)、erode(腐蚀)、getStructuringElement(锚框的形状)代码如下(示例):...

2022-06-16 13:57:50 712

原创 [图像处理学习笔记Opencv]双边滤波

双边滤波原理

2022-06-15 19:01:33 196

原创 【C++学习笔记】运算符重载的理解

文章目录一、什么是运算符重载二、运算符重载原理三、实战1.类成员定义2.函数实现3 主函数总结一、什么是运算符重载重新定义运算符的功能,比如实现加、减、乘、除、括号等运算符其他功能。让程序可读性更强。二、运算符重载原理比如两个整数相加:int a=2;int b=3;int c=a+b;可以把加号看成int类里面的一个函数,即:int a=2;int b=3;int c=a.+(b);也就是:加号为函数,加号前面为类对象本身,加号后面函数参数。那么,加号函数是怎么定义的呢?

2022-05-26 15:23:28 336

原创 【C++ 学习笔记】函数指针与回调函数

文章目录一、什么是函数指针二、用函数指针接收函数的地址三、指针调用函数四、什么是回调函数一、什么是函数指针首先,在C++中,函数名=函数地址。如代码所示:#include <iostream>using namespace std;int add(int a, int b);int main(){ cout << add << endl;}int add(int a, int b) { return a + b;}输出结果:00391

2022-05-14 18:39:39 232

原创 【C++学习笔记】引用&

文章目录什么是引用一、引用的妙用1.普通函数(值传递)2.引用传递的函数注意事项什么是引用引用是变量的别名,相当于一个人有两个名字,大名和小名。有什么用?一、引用的妙用1.普通函数(值传递)定义一个变量自增1的函数,代码如下(示例):#include <iostream>using namespace std;void add(int a);int main(){ int ini = 0; cout << ini << endl; a

2022-05-09 13:32:42 197

原创 【C++ 学习笔记】自定义函数之寻找回文数

文章目录题目一、题目分解二、代码实现1.函数定义2.函数实现3.主函数4.输出结果注意事项题目寻找并输出11~999之间的数m,它满足m、m2和m3均为回文数。回文:各位数字左右对称的整数。列如:11满足上述条件。11^2=121。11^3=1331。一、题目分解首先判断输入的位数,再判断第一位和最后一位是否相等,第二位和倒数第二位是否相等……。故定义两个函数,分别为计算输入位数的函数,和判别是否为回文数的函数。二、代码实现1.函数定义代码如下(示例):#include &lt

2022-05-05 23:54:36 1750

原创 【C++ 学习笔记】自定义函数计算Π

文章目录一、Π的计算公式二、题目分解三、实现步骤1.函数声明2.函数定义3.主函数注意事项一、Π的计算公式二、题目分解题目可以分解为两个函数。分别为求幂次函数和求反正切函数。三、实现步骤1.函数声明代码如下(示例):#include <iostream>using namespace std;double power(double x, int num);double arctan(double x);double get_pai();2.函数定义代码如

2022-05-05 12:47:00 1251

原创 【C++学习笔记】数组

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录前言数组原理1.代码演示2.代码讲解总结前言数组是一组数据的集合,可以为整形数组、浮点型数组、字符数组、指针数组等等。在C\C++中,数组名为数组的地址,且是数组首元素的地址。数组原理1.代码演示代码如下(示例):#include <iostream>using namespace std;int main(){ cout << "----------------------.

2022-05-03 17:24:51 215

原创 【C++学习笔记】文件的读写

文件的读写详细用法

2022-05-03 15:49:46 1215

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除